Self-insemination, also known as self-impregnation or self-fertilization, is the process of a woman intentionally impregnating herself without the use of a medical professional or a male partner. This can be done through various methods such as at-home insemination kits, self-insemination using a sperm donor, or even using a known donor. While it may not be the traditional way of conceiving, self-insemination has provided many women, especially those in the LGBTQ+ community, with the opportunity to start a family on their own terms.

One of the biggest advantages of self-insemination is the control and autonomy it gives to women over their own fertility. Many women who have chosen this path have expressed a sense of empowerment and pride in their decision. They have taken charge of their own bodies and have not let societal expectations dictate their choices. This is especially true for women in same-sex relationships who have always been told that they cannot have children without a male partner. Self-insemination has given them the chance to prove that they can create a family and be amazing mothers without conforming to traditional norms.

Another reason why self-insemination is becoming increasingly popular is the high cost of assisted fertility treatments. The average cost of a single round of artificial insemination can range from $300 to $1000, making it unattainable for many women. By choosing self-insemination, women can save a significant amount of money while still achieving their dreams of becoming a mother. This option also allows women to have more control over the timing and frequency of insemination, which can increase their chances of pregnancy.

While self-insemination may seem like a straightforward process, it is not without its challenges. One of the biggest concerns for women is the safety and reliability of the sperm donor. Unlike traditional medical insemination, self-insemination does not involve screening and testing of the sperm donor. This can be a daunting task for women as they want to ensure that their child will not have any potential genetic or health issues. However, with proper research and careful selection, many women have successfully found trustworthy and suitable sperm donors.
